Depends where you want to end up working really, but in my neck of the woods (London & the South East) the names that come up often are London Helicopters at Redhill, Fast at Shoreham, Heli-Air at Wycombe and Wellesbourne, and Helicopter Services at Wycombe. There is a full list of UK schools on the CAA website here.

Can't help with the BFR I'm afraid.

Many people consider careful choice of instructor is much more important than choice of school.




For professional qualifications, the UK Instructors who have been most consistently highly recommended in this forum over the past 5 years or so are:
CPL(H) courses
Mike Green (Helicopter Services, Wycombe)
Leon Smith (same school)
(Apparently there are two Mike Greens. This one used to be at Fast Helicopters but has moved and now works with Leon Smith.)
FI(H) courses
Mike Green
Leon Smith
Mike Smith (HeliAir, Wellesbourne)

If you're R22 rated, Helicopter services are excellent for their CPL and FI - I did my FI with Mike up there and he exemplified professionalism, by the book teaching.

If you're 300 oriented, you could try BHH down in Kent for the Commercial. No FI courses there yet though, so if you're wanting to keep up continuity, might be worth talking to Mike first anyhow.
